The Vendry is now part of Groupize! Read more

Back Lawn

Located In: Mountain Lodge Telluride

Standing: 60

Mountain Lodge Telluride

Mountain Lodge Telluride

Back Lawn
Address
Mountain Lodge Telluride

457 Mountain Village Boulevard Telluride, CO 81435

Business Space Location Map
Capacity

Standing: 60

Square Feet: 2,000 ft2

F&B Options
In-house catering
Features
  • Outdoor Area
  • Great Views
Frequent Uses
  • Private Dining
Overview

Enjoy an outdoor cocktail hour or lawn games on a private grassy area.